MACH 2010 is 70 per cent sold

  • MACH 2010 exhibition manufacturing technology
The MTA's MACH 2010 exhibition is already almost 70 per cent sold following the third ballot for stand space.

With just over a year to go before MACH 2010, just under 15,000 sq m of stand space has already been sold to nearly 200 exhibitors; over half of which are MTA members. While that's a good show of confidence in the industry, the MACH team are expecting space sales to peak much nearer to the show than in 2008.

Graham Shearsmith, MTA exhibition manager commented: "We expect MACH to be a harder sell this year, but are encouraged by the commitment to space that we have received so far. The market does appear to be holding up, and the average stand size is in line with those of 2008. We know too that there are a good number of additional exhibitors who have not committed contractually to the show as yet, but will almost certainly be attending".

MACH 2010 takes place from 7-11 June 2010 at the NEC Birmingham.
